I have found out the root cause of my Lumia's battery issue these days. I have tried turning off NFC, Bluetooth and other background apps before. But since Skype doesn't show up in the background apps, I did not realize that it could be the cause. Since I did that yesterday, I still have 63% left, even after a day's usage. Before that, I would run out of battery before 2pm!
